Background
When a clinic roster becomes large, quality of client care may be affected. The main reason why a POS would like to be setup as Team-based is to divide up clients into two distinct teams so that a group of providers only need to familiarize themselves with a subset of the clinic roster, which will ultimately allow providers to provide better quality care.

Configuration
1. Navigate to Maintain > Short Codes
2. In Type column, select Primary Care POS List which defines list of POSes available as PC POS
3. Modify existing code from TBR to TBR1 and leave description as is
4. Create new code for TBR2 with same TBR description
This results in ability to display both Teams under PC POS in Yellow Bar and Client Registration Form:
Existing code in Update Providers, PC POS and Alt POS form will auto-create the Full Name of the clinic in Client Registration Form as well.
Other Considerations
Workbooks: User List
- Clarify which user roles will belong to Team-based POS
- Providers only
- Providers and Nursing
- Generally, there are not enough Allied Health, Specialists, and CSCs to be divided into teams
- Add another column to User List workbook for clinic leadership to identify which users belong to which team
Appointment Types
Available Team-based appointment types are:
- T1 Booked which replaces Consult
- T2 Booked which replaces Consult
- T1 Walk In which replaces Walk In
- T2 Walk In which replaces Walk In
Distribution/Task Groups
Depending on which users will be divided to Teams, create team based task groups as well.
Generally, nurses will need to be a part of BOTH groups so that they can cover for each other when there are staffing issues. Nurses will sort the task list by Holder to identify which team's task group they are processing.
Note: You may need to keep the main distribution group active until Go Live and all tasks have been reassigned to the Team-based distribution groups
